Heroin prices
But let's not stop there! We have also heard about “heroin prices” on our products. Let me make it clear right away, we distance ourselves from the use and sale of drugs. However, we have heard that some believe that our products are very expensive, as much as heroin prices. Why is this?
Firstly, our production is in Norway and many of the tents and lavvos that we compete against are, for example, produced in Asia. In Norway we have both better working conditions and higher wages than what is generally found in Asia. The wage costs for Arctic Lavvo are significantly higher and make a big difference compared to the products we compete with.
Secondly, we value local value creation, and try to trade locally with Nordic and European suppliers. An example here is textiles, in Norway there are no textile manufacturers. There are a few in Europe, our textile is produced in the Netherlands. Even though it has a higher cost price than an Asian textile, we feel more confident in the quality and working conditions of those who produce it in Europe.
Thirdly, we also repair free of charge for private customers for three years after the date of purchase, which we can do because we have the production in Norway. In addition, I believe Arctic Lavvo has a higher quality, has a longer lifespan for the products and provides a better offer to our customers. For example, we can offer special adaptations and special productions because the production is in Norway versus Asia.
